Course details
Blockchain Fundamentals for Supply Chain Management in Hospitality - This unit introduces the concept of blockchain technology, its applications, and its potential impact on supply chain management in the hospitality industry. •
Smart Contracts for Supply Chain Management - This unit explores the use of smart contracts in supply chain management, including their benefits, limitations, and implementation strategies. •
Supply Chain Visibility and Transparency with Blockchain - This unit focuses on the role of blockchain technology in improving supply chain visibility and transparency, including its applications in inventory management and tracking. •
Identity Management and Verification in Blockchain-based Supply Chains - This unit discusses the importance of identity management and verification in blockchain-based supply chains, including the use of blockchain-based identity management systems. •
Regulatory Compliance and Governance in Blockchain-based Supply Chains - This unit examines the regulatory compliance and governance requirements for blockchain-based supply chains, including the need for clear regulations and standards. •
Blockchain-based Inventory Management Systems - This unit explores the use of blockchain technology in inventory management systems, including its benefits, limitations, and implementation strategies. •
Supply Chain Risk Management with Blockchain - This unit discusses the role of blockchain technology in supply chain risk management, including its applications in identifying and mitigating risks. •
Blockchain-based Payment Systems for Supply Chains - This unit examines the use of blockchain technology in payment systems for supply chains, including its benefits, limitations, and implementation strategies. •
Blockchain for Sustainable Supply Chains - This unit explores the potential of blockchain technology in promoting sustainable supply chains, including its applications in reducing waste and improving environmental sustainability. •
Implementation and Integration of Blockchain in Hospitality Supply Chains - This unit discusses the practical aspects of implementing and integrating blockchain technology in hospitality supply chains, including the need for clear communication and collaboration among stakeholders.
Career path
|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Blockchain Operations Manager | Oversees the implementation and maintenance of blockchain technology in hospitality supply chains, ensuring seamless data exchange and secure transactions. |
| Supply Chain Blockchain Analyst | Analyzes data to identify trends and opportunities in blockchain-based supply chain management, providing insights to inform business decisions. |
| Digital Transformation Consultant | Helps hospitality businesses implement blockchain technology to enhance their supply chain management, improving efficiency and reducing costs. |
| Blockchain Data Scientist | Develops and implements machine learning models to analyze blockchain data, identifying patterns and trends to inform business strategy. |
